Ector County ISD School Nutrition Department is soliciting sealed bids for the delivery of milk and dairy products to approximately 39 campus locations. The awarded vendor must provide direct-to-campus delivery in accordance with specified schedules and requirements, with all prices firm and inclusive of delivery costs. The contract term is one year with an option to renew, and bids will be awarded as a package to the lowest responsive and responsible bidder. Delivery must comply with USDA and FDA standards, and alternate products require sample submission for evaluation.
